Top Soccer Games Performance in Lithuania: Q3 2025
Explore the performance of the top 5 soccer games on a unified platform in Lithuania during Q3 2025, featuring insights from Sensor Tower.
In the third quarter of 2025, Lithuania saw notable trends in the soccer games category on a unified platform, with data sourced from Sensor Tower providing insights into weekly downloads, revenue, and active user metrics.
EA SPORTS FC™ Mobile Soccer from Electronic Arts demonstrated a fluctuating pattern in weekly revenue, peaking at approximately $3.8K in early September. The game experienced a decline in weekly downloads from early July, reaching a low of about 214 by mid-August, but ended the quarter with an uptick to 526. Active users started at 8.6K, declining mid-quarter, and rebounded to 7.7K by the end of September.
Top Eleven Be a Soccer Manager by Nordeus saw weekly revenue peak at $1.2K in mid-August before declining to $539 by the end of September. Downloads remained relatively stable, fluctuating between 43 and 62 weekly. Active users showed a slight decrease from 1.8K to 1.6K throughout the quarter.
For Football Rivals: Soccer Game by Green Horse Games Srl, revenue started strong at $1K in late June, then gradually decreased to $463 by the end of September. Downloads and active users remained low, with minor fluctuations.
eFootball™ by KONAMI had stable weekly downloads, peaking at 81 mid-quarter, while revenue showed a resurgence in the final week, reaching $771. Active users hovered around 2.6K with slight variations.
Lastly, Dream League Soccer 2025 from First Touch Games Ltd. experienced a peak in revenue at $536 in mid-July but saw a decline to $57 by the end of the quarter. Downloads were steady, ranging between 38 and 75 weekly, with active users decreasing from 485 to 387.
